A resting electrocardiogram (ECG), also known as a resting EKG, is a common diagnostic tool used to evaluate the conductivity of your heart while you are at complete stillness. During the test, small electrodes are placed to your chest, arms, and legs to record the impulses produced by your heart as it functions. The resulting tracings provide valuable insights about your heart's structure, including its speed, rhythm, and the presence of any abnormalities.

A resting ECG is a safe, painless, and non-invasive procedure. It can be used to detect a variety of heart conditions, such as irregular heartbeats, coronary artery disease, and heart failure.

  • Keep in mind that a resting ECG may not always detect all potential heart problems.
  • Consequently, your doctor may order further examinations if needed.

Electrocardiogram during Exercise

Exercise stress electrocardiography are a non-invasive test used to evaluate the heart's function under physical exertion. During this procedure, electrodes is placed on the chest to monitor the ECG. The patient often rides a stationary bicycle on a treadmill or exercise bike while their vital signs are being measured closely.

The test helps identify potential problems with the heart, such as coronary artery disease or arrhythmias. The process includes gradually increasing the intensity of exercise until a certain target heart rate has been achieved.

At conclusion of the test, the electrocardiogram tracing provides a visual representation to assess the heart's response to exercise and identify any abnormalities.

Holter Monitor Recording

Continuous ambulatory holter monitoring, also known as a portable EKG, is a reliable method for recording the heart's electrical activity over an extended period. This non-invasive device enables physicians to pinpoint potential irregularities that may not be apparent during a limited electrocardiogram (ECG) test. Patients typically carry the holter monitor for an entire duration or even extended periods, recording their heart click here rhythm continuously during daily activities. The collected data is then reviewed by a cardiologist, who can determine a diagnosis and suggest appropriate treatment alternatives.
